    Experiences and Future Expectations towards Online Courses –An Empirical Study of the B2C-and B2B-Segments

    Get PDF
    This article explores the future potential for the development of online courses. The findings are based on an empirical study with 3 sample groups: (1) B2C segment in Germany, (2) B2C segment in the United States, and (3) B2B segment (international). In the first step the status quo of the use of e-learning in general and online courses in particular is presented. Subsequently, the expectations of potential users concerning the design of online courses are determined. Respondents were segmented according to their basic needs, based on ten distinct attributes relevant for the decision-making process. Thirdly, an innovative concept for online courses is reviewed as part of a concept test. Since people increasingly watch (short) videos instead of reading documents, the authors emphasize that creators of online courses can take advantage of this development, provided they adapt their formats to the changed communication behavior of potential users

    Mobile Gaming with Indirect Sensor Control

    No full text
    Part 11: PostersInternational audienceThe rapid growth of the mobile gaming market and the steadily improved hardware of mobile phones enable developers to create complex and extensive 3D games on mobile phones. While most current casual games have simple interfaces with few buttons, 3D games require new control interfaces to providing sufficient control options without limiting the field of view on the screen. This is important to improve the user experience. Within this work new ideas based on the use of the accelerometer as indirect control mechanism are presented. The accelerometer is used to switch between different interaction layers, which are also different game views for the player. Combined with this concept a buttonless touch area interface is used. We are planning to evaluate the ideas with a 3D game prototype running on Android devices
